LADWP Crews are Prepared for Winter Storm Warning in Effect in the Eastern Sierra

BISHOP (November 17, 2025) - The National Weather Service announced a Winter Storm Warning in Effect in the Eastern Sierra from 10 AM Monday, November 17 to 10PM Tuesday, November 18. Heavy snow expected. Los Angeles Department of Water and Power (LADWP) aqueduct division and power system crews are monitoring the storm system and prepared to respond.

  • Heavy snow expected.
  • Slippery road conditions along State Route 168 to Aspendell and through Westgard Pass.
  • Inyo County Road Closures are available.
  • Consider delaying travel if possible. If travel is necessary, use extreme caution. Keep an extra flashlight, food, and water in your vehicle in case of an emergency. Call 1-800-427-7623 for road information.
